About The Position

The Shipping Lead is responsible for executing all daily shipping activities while ensuring customer orders are shipped accurately, on time, and in accordance with company priorities. This position serves as the primary coordinator between Shipping, Planning, Production, Customer Service, and Transportation to remove shipping constraints, manage priorities, and ensure accurate system transactions. The Shipping Lead owns the daily execution of the shipping process, provides leadership to shipping personnel, monitors shipment readiness, and proactively resolves issues that could impact customer delivery performance.

Responsibilities

  • Coordinate and prioritize daily shipments to meet customer requested ship dates and business priorities.
  • Oversee shipment execution, ensuring orders are loaded accurately, safely, and efficiently.
  • Monitor shipment progress throughout the day and resolve issues that could impact delivery commitments.
  • Manage shipping activities within SAP and TMS, including shipment creation, delivery validation, PGI processing, and error resolution.
  • Partner with Planning, Production, Customer Service, and Transportation teams to align shipping priorities and address changing customer needs.
  • Track shipment readiness by identifying and driving resolution of quality holds, assembly delays, documentation gaps, material shortages, customer holds, and transportation constraints.
  • Provide timely communication on shipment status, delivery risks, and expedited shipping requirements.
  • Monitor key performance metrics including on-time shipping, daily shipment goals, shipping accuracy, dock throughput, freight issues, and carrier performance.
  • Lead continuous improvement efforts to enhance shipping processes, reduce errors, improve dock efficiency, and support Lean initiatives.
  • Train and support shipping associates while promoting safety, accountability, teamwork, and compliance with established procedures.
